I just did some wikipedia searching cause I was curious. Looks like he is distributed under ADA:

 

It's not unheard of to have mainstream success with an independent label that is still distributed by a major. Smash by the Offspring sold over 10 million records this way. I'm not sure if any special credit is due. Maybe.

 

What IS impossible, though, is to achieve mainstream success without major label distribution. Radio stations are not independent entities that play whatever they think people should hear. They are a marketing tool of major labels that are part of billion dollar corporations.
